I moved into a new house recently and it has a tree with dark green leaves and it beares small round yellowish fruit in bunches about 4-10 and when you pluck them they come off with the stems. The skin comes off easily like a peach and also has the same texture, and the pulp inside is slightly whitish and translucent. It has a single round brownish seed inside. It is the size of a quarter. I tried to look up google images but could not find it
